Source: Cologne Digital Sanskrit Dictionaries: Böhtlingk and Roth Grosses Petersburger WörterbuchJālaki (जालकि):—patron.; pl. Nomen proprium eines zu den Trigarta gezählten Volksstammes; jālakīya ein Fürst dieses Stammes Kār. zu [Pāṇini’s acht Bücher 5, 3, 116.]
Source: Cologne Digital Sanskrit Dictionaries: Sanskrit-Wörterbuch in kürzerer FassungJālaki (जालकि):—m. Pl. Nomen proprium eines Volksstammes. jānaki v.l.
